Dimensional National Municipal Bond ETF (NYSEARCA:DFNM – Get Free Report) saw a large decline in short interest in August. As of August 14th, there was short interest totaling 40,727 shares, a decline of 54.7% from the July 30th total of 89,829 shares. Based on an average daily trading volume, of 213,367 shares, the days-to-cover ratio is currently 0.2 days. Currently, 0.1% of the shares of the stock are short sold.

About Dimensional National Municipal Bond ETF
The Dimensional National Municipal Bond ETF (DFNM) is an exchange-traded fund that mostly invests in investment grade fixed income. The fund is an actively managed ETF that provides exposure to intermediate-term, investment-grade municipal bonds that are exempt from federal income tax. DFNM was launched on Dec 15, 2021 and is managed by Dimensional.
